- Carl R. Atkinson - August 21, 1916 - December 5, 1997. Son of John and Cassie Joyner Atkinson. Husband of Cynthia Wadsworth Atkinson & Betty Munson. Section 5, Row 23.
Newspaper Obituary - Sunday, December 7, 1997 Watertown Daily Times - Watertown, New York - Carl R. Atkinson Retired Dairy Farmer - Carl R. Atkinson, 81, of 9685 Reshaw Bay Road, formerly of Pulaski, died Friday at Oswego Hospital. Mr. Atkinson resided in Pulaski for 62 years, moving to Mannsville in 1978. He owned and operated a dairy farm in Pulaski for more than 50 years and was a cattle dealer for more than 40 years. He also was a salesman for Hoffman Seed Co. for 50 years and a state inspector at Vernon Downs for 10 years. He was a 50-year member of Pulaski Grange 730, a member of Oswego County Farm Bureau and the Daysville Cemetery board and a trustee of Bethel Community Center, Port Ontario. Born August 21, 1916, in Daysville, son of John W. and Cassia Joyner Atkinson, he attended Pulaski Schools. He married Cynthia Wadsworth July 13, 1938. She died February 16, 1965. He married Betty Munson October 5, 1978. Surviving besides his wife are five sons, Nelson V., James W., Larry G. and Thomas D., all of Pulaski, and Donald A., Tarpon Springs, Florida; a stepson, John D. Munson, Lacona; a sister, Gladys Wadsworth, Pulaski; 19 grandchildren, eight great-grandchildren and several nieces and nephews.
